What bullion buyers can expect

Bullion in Hatton Garden covers far more than coins and bars. Suppliers stock precious metal in sheet, wire, tube, grain and solder, the raw materials that goldsmiths turn into finished jewellery every day.

Prices track the spot market closely, so quotes move with global gold and silver rates. Reputable dealers are transparent about the premium they add over spot, which lets you compare offers fairly before you buy.

Supplies for jewellery making

Many bullion houses double as full suppliers for jewellery tools and equipment, carrying findings, chains, beading materials and gemstone strings alongside the metal itself.

This makes the area a practical destination for makers and hobbyists as well as established workshops. You can source metal, tools and stones in a single visit, often with technical advice from staff who craft jewellery themselves.

Buying with confidence

When buying bullion or selling scrap, ask how the metal is assayed and weighed. London has a long tradition of hallmarking through the London Assay Office, and dealing with established traders protects you on both price and purity.

Greville Street and Leather Lane sit at the heart of this trade, with Chancery Lane and Farringdon stations a short walk away. Visiting in person lets you inspect stock and agree terms directly.
